Core Concept

Pay by mobile casinos enable deposits through mobile carrier billing or direct mobile wallet integration. Instead of entering bank or card details, the charge is added to a phone bill or deducted from prepaid balance.

That streamlined approach reduces friction and can increase privacy because financial details are not shared with the casino. Operators integrate with payment providers that handle the interface with carriers and mobile wallets.

The model works best for smaller deposits and is popular with casual players who want instant access without lengthy verification. It is important to understand limits, fees, and withdrawal rules before relying on it as a primary funding method.

How It Works or Steps

  • Open the casino site or app on your mobile device and navigate to the cashier or deposit section.
  • Select the pay by mobile casinos option or carrier billing as the payment method.
  • Enter the deposit amount, keeping in mind the provider’s minimums and maximums.
  • Confirm your phone number and accept any required SMS verification or one-time PIN.
  • Authorize the charge; the amount posts to your monthly bill or reduces your prepaid credit immediately.
  • Check your casino balance to confirm the deposit landed, then start playing.
  • If available, review transaction details in both the casino account and your phone bill to verify charges.

These steps are typically fast and require minimal personal data. However, casinos often restrict withdrawals to other methods, so plan how you will access winnings.

Payment/Costs (if relevant)

Costs vary by provider and carrier. Some pay by mobile casinos absorb fees to remain competitive, while others pass on a small processing charge to the player. Carrier billing generally favors smaller amounts, so percentage-based fees can matter more on tiny deposits.

Always check the deposit confirmation for any explicit fee and review your mobile bill for the final posted amount. Fees and exchange rates may apply for cross-border transactions.

FAQs

Q1: Are pay by mobile casinos available worldwide?

A1: Availability depends on regional carriers and local regulations. Some countries and mobile operators support carrier billing broadly, while others restrict it, so check your carrier and the casino’s payment options.

Q2: Can I withdraw winnings back to my phone bill?

A2: Typically no; most operators allow deposits via mobile billing but require bank transfers, e-wallets, or other methods for withdrawals. Expect extra verification steps when cashing out.

Q3: Are there fees for using pay by mobile casinos?

A3: Fees vary. Some casinos or carriers charge a small processing fee, while others do not. Always review the deposit confirmation and carrier bill to confirm any charges.
